In addition, there were multiple volunteers to be City Council representatives for the
Janesville Innovations Center Advisory Committee. This Committee will be making
recommendations on the structure of a 501c3 Board and determining various
components of the final composition of the 501c3 structure. Council President Voskuil
recommends appointing Councilmember Kealy and Councilmember Farrell to this
Advisory Committee.

Presentations regarding role and purpose of the Police & Fire Commission
Musickshared an overview of the PFC, including the role and purpose of the Committee, as requested by the
Committeeat their March meeting. The PFC is required by state statute for any community greater than 4,000
residents in population.
